Owning your dream home is a wonderful goal for most people. But the conventional mortgage process can sometimes be lengthy. That's where private mortgages arrive in. A private mortgage is a financing that is provided by a individual lender, rather than a traditional bank or financial institution. This can present several benefits for borrowers who may not qualify for a typical mortgage.

The primary pro of a private mortgage is that lenders are often more flexible with their requirements. They may be willing to accept borrowers who have limited credit history, lower credit scores, or unique income situations. Furthermore, private lenders may be faster to approve loan applications, which can save time and hassle.

Bridge the Gap: Private Mortgage Solutions for Challenging Credit

For individuals facing credit challenges, acquiring a traditional mortgage can seem like an insurmountable barrier. Fortunately, private mortgage solutions provide alternative path to homeownership. These programs are designed to accommodate borrowers with less-than-perfect credit scores by offering more lenient lending criteria. With a private mortgage, you may be able to access financing even if you have past defaults.

Private lenders often focus on your earnings and current economic situation rather than solely relying on your credit history. This can provide doors to homeownership for those who have faced difficulties in the past.

  • Research different private mortgage lenders to find one that best aligns with your needs.
  • Boost your credit score whenever possible, as it can still influence the terms of your loan.
  • Become transparent about your financial history with the lender to build trust and increase your chances of approval.
